Im using a 4 port kvm switch to change video/audio between the ssb pc and my mame pc. For the controls I am using a db25 switch. I have 2 xin mo encoder's that I am using. But only because the wires are to short to use only one. They take care of the 10 buttons and joys per player. I am also using a kade with the kb/mouse firmware that covers enter, esc, tap and pause. I only need 5 buttons for ssb, so they are piggy backed to 3 of player 1 buttons and 2 of player 2 buttons. I used a db25 breakout board, wired it with the ssb buttons and the 8 wires for the track ball. So when the switch is on A, the controls go to the mame pc for the trackball. B they share the 5 buttons and trackball for ssb. I can take pictures, skype, google talk if you need more details.
